Jenny Williams is a Consultant for Women, Speaker and host of the 'Unlock Your Happiness' Series Podcast. She helps women find Calm in the Chaos by redefining success without the burnout.At just 30, Jenny became MD of a £6M turnover company, living first hand the pressures of corporate chaos. After experiencing overwhelm, she realised that calm isn't a luxury....it's a strategy.
